Latest Patents

Nishimoto's latest patents focus on the production of 1-deoxyxylulose 5-phosphate (DXP) and its derived compounds. The inventions provide genetically modified host cells capable of producing DXP, which is crucial for various biochemical processes. The patents detail methods involving a mutant RibB or functional variants that catalyze the conversion of xylulose 5-phosphate and ribulose 5-phosphate to DXP. Additionally, the inventions include the use of YajO and XylB functional variants to enhance production efficiency.
